Nav 2013 report save as pdf

How to get a dynamics nav report with a web service. Can you save fornav reports as pdf, word, excel, or xml. Temporary datasets in reports in dynamics nav 20 r2. Instead, save them as pdf, word, or excel and then print them. Hi guys, another post about my how to posts series.

Conclusion, now you can give this url to people who dont have access to dynamics nav, and they can execute the report when they see a need for this. The trick is to save the report usage in a temporary table first inside a singleinstance codeunit. Thanks to microsoft reporting services pdf rendering extension, all rtc reports can be exported to pdf. On which we will perform the action to convert the report to a pdf. In order to get the pdf, that gets generated on the service tier, available on the client tier, we need to copy the file from the server to the client.

I am adding options to save as in the action of the posted sales invoice page as shown below. In the microsoft dynamics nav development environment, select an. In nav 2017 emailing the pdf by running the report using report. After checking their license, i saw that they did have permission to run a dynamics nav server. Rdlc export directly to excel or pdf from codebehind the. How to upgrade nav 2009 reports to nav 20 report youtube. If you want to save the fornav report in a report object, you need a developer license application builder or solution developer for microsoft dynamics nav. System requirements for microsoft dynamics nav 20 r2.

Ever have an issue with a nav 20 r2 report where a certain text box would get excluded from the pdf output file save as pdf on request page. The first example is emailing sales invoices as pdf using a stream without saving the report into the file system. Select and download one of the following packages depending on the country version of your microsoft dynamics nav 20 database. Thus this blog demonstrates the workaround solution for this issue. Now its time to expose this codeunit as web service. I am currently generating the report as a pdf programatically but want to save the reports without the user having to choose the save option manually each time. Saveaspdf function report dynamics nav microsoft docs. Jun 20, 2017 on which we will perform the action to convert the report to a pdf.

The first of it is working that is making pdf of the report but it shoudt print the report along with it. Instead of having actions that run reports, execute a codeunit that saves the report to pdf and then launches it. Cumulative update 17 for microsoft dynamics nav 20 build. Backup 1 best practices analyzer for microsoft dynamics nav 20 1. Jul, 2015 this article explains a way for sending an email with pdf attachment in nav 20 r2. The reports fornav converter makes classic to rdlc fast and easy. Nav recommend report name, but you can use your own. This section gives us a temporary file name in a temporary location and saves our customer top 10 as pdf to this path. For a network directory, you can also use the universal naming convention unc path, like \\servername\sharename\folder\filename. In this demo, we are going to learn how to create a report upgrade path from dynamics nav 5. Microsoft dynamics nav database components for sql server requirements. How to print reports to pdf and send email roberto. In nav 20, if you run the windows client via a terminal server or remote desktop connection rdc or some common 3rd party application host technology, reports may be difficult to read when you print them. Microsoft report viewer 2015 for save as excel, save as pdf, and save as.

Instead of using the request page to obtain parameters at runtime, the function gets the parameter values as an input parameter string, typically from the return value of a runrequestpage function call. Nav 20 reports may be difficult to read when printing. Navision classic save report in pdf file as user defined. Images will show unexpected lines at the edges of the image when printed. No regulatory features are included in update rollup 2 for microsoft dynamics nav 20 r2. Nav 20 sample report to create pdf in batch mode in this case. Jun 25, 2015 after checking their license, i saw that they did have permission to run a dynamics nav server. Saving designs in custom layouts or report objects. Hi i developing the report system, i am using rdlc for generate report, i am almost finish my report work,now my problem is the report is automatically create in pdf format and send the particular client. Lets discuss what is required to use these options as then try to use them.

Provide a button on customer card, on click event the report should be saved in pdf as per path defined. Laura is also a coauthor of the book implementing microsoft dynamics nav 20, which had really good comments coming from different dynamics nav experts. Here is the function called customertop10 in our codeunit. If you want to save the fornav report in a report object, you need a developer license application builder or. How to save commonly used filters in dynamics nav often when we work in dynamics nav, we use the same filters and settings over and over again.

Add the printer to nav and select it in the code that runs the report. How to save rdlc report in pdf format in windows application. On the view menu, click layout to open visual studio report designer. Printing pdf reports in classic without external components. Oct 18, 2011 you can save rdlc reports as pdf documents in dynamics nav 2009 r2 to be fair, you could do this for years now starting with dynamics nav 2009. We can save report in stream objects than after convert to file using blob export function. Email documents as pdf using streams i started collecting some code pieces that i find myself using often on github. Jul 11, 2012 microsoft dynamics nav 20 warehouse and inventory management supply chain management module duration. How to print reports to pdf and send email roberto stefanetti. As you can only have a maximum length of 250 characters for a text field in nav tables, it is often the need to store longer text related to a record.

We will use dynamics nav 2009 r2 as the intermediate version for our work. When activating this button, we get the report specified in codeunit 50000 displayed as an pdf file in our browser. The client dll is automatically deployed from the server to the client in 20, you have to. This cumulative update has multiple hotfix packages. Tectura internal presentation on nav 20 reports on march, 20. This path can be a local drive or mapped network directory, such as c. Announcement nav 2009 nav 20 development nav 20 r2 nav 2015 tax updates sql nav 2016 nav 2009 r2 reporting nav 5. Here is the sample code to download work order report in pdf file with customize file name. Since its a nav client feature i dont think its possible to customize. Send dynamics nav rtc reports and documents as pdf. Desired output an email will be sent through outlook which is configured on the workstation where nav client is installed.

Hi i developing the report system, i am using rdlc for generate report, i am almost finish my report work,now my problem is the report is automatically create in pdf format and send the particular client emailid,i dont how its possible, so pls send your ideas. Hahaha, i had a good laugh about great pains it might be a competitor of horracle erp. Reports fornav converter microsoft dynamics nav reports. Update rollup 2 for microsoft dynamics nav 20 r2 build 35800. Runs a specific report without a request page and saves the report as a pdf, excel, word, or xml file. Reporting in microsoft dynamics nav 20 5 4 exporting a report the reportviewer toolbar provides export formats so that you can save a report as an excel, pdf or word program file. The benefit of this type of codeunits is that all variables are stored in client memory during the lifetime of the session. Hi guys, this article explains a way for sending an email with pdf attachment in nav 20 r2. Using dynamics nav web services to send a pdf to a web. Save as doc from request page works, the doc file contains the text box with my text box in it. Apr 09, 2020 cumulative update cu 17 for microsoft dynamics nav 20. Rdlc export directly to excel or pdf from codebehind. After that, we will create a report which will work with temporary data. Can you save rdlc reports as pdf documents in dynamics nav.

We will use the same method, that is, saving the document header and document. In nav 20 we have the option to use native saveaspdf command that uses builtin methods to create a pdf document on the server. Click the ok button to convert the report to rdlc 2008 format. I have a report that i need to run multiple times and save as pdfs. Cumulative update cu 17 for microsoft dynamics nav 20. The filename parameter specifies a location on the computer running microsoft dynamics nav server. Working with images in rdlc reports and visual studio 2010 in nav 20 are unfortunately not done without doing some workarounds. From the cal editor, on the view menu, choose cal symbol menu to select the report from a list. Web services right, the web service is also executed on the nav server, so it is able to save report as pdf. Mibuso how to save navision reports as pdf mibuso pdfcreator mibuso print report to pdf throught code mibuso automatic sending customer statement document by email mibuso email to multiple recipients. Implementing microsoft dynamics nav 20 ebook packt. When the user clicks ok, the function simply returns a text value, which is an xml document describing the users.

In visual studio return the byte array to a file format. Microsoft office 365, microsoft office 2016, microsoft office 20 service pack. Before you run a report in your code, you must set the parameters for the next print job. For this example, i will use the standard report 5057 salesperson todos.

But how to do this, without needing to redesign all your forms into pages and letting the user work on the role tailored client. I used the job queue in nav 2009 to send all my invoices and credit memos via email to my customers. Open the object designer, locate report 1 customeritem sales and click the design button. Aug 28, 2017 in visual studio return the byte array to a file format. User based on his requirement can specify the path where the pdf file should be saved. How to run a report, save it as pdf and send to email. You can specify whether fonts are embedded in the pdf for rdlc reports by changing the report pdf font embedding setting in the microsoft dynamics nav server instance configuration or changing the pdffontembedding property in report objects. I have designed a report and i would like to save each report in pdf into a specifi folder. When the user clicks ok, the function simply returns a text value, which is an xml document describing the users selection and filters of the request. The report is designed to have the customer table as the top level data item, with item ledger entry and integer tables indented.

She also contributes by sharing her knowledge and experience with the spanish dynamics nav community. Feb 25, 20 in nav 20, if you run the windows client via a terminal server or remote desktop connection rdc or some common 3rd party application host technology, reports may be difficult to read when you print them. The same report can have a different appearance and functionality, depending on the rendering format that you select. Microsoft report viewer 2012 is required for save as excel or save as pdf functionality. How to generate pdf report automatically in dynamics nav stack. Aug, 20 provide a button on customer card, on click event the report should be saved in pdf as per path defined. Saveaspdf to save the pdf file from the rtc client side if i say call. By mark brummel author of microsoft dynamics nav 20 application design. In other words, how to create a conditional page break in a microsoft dynamics nav 20 rtc report. Save as option in nav 20 microsoft dynamics nav forum. Jan 26, 2009 when activating this button, we get the report specified in codeunit 50000 displayed as an pdf file in our browser.

Then, the field information from the report sections is converted to a dataset definition that is valid for microsoft. The path and name of the file that you want to save the report as. Nav 2009 1 nav 20 4 navigation pane 1 navision news 1 navision slow 1. And after release of nav 20 there is one more addition to the list. If you click save, you must specify a path for saving the compressed file. Runrequestpage, execute, print, saveas in nav roberto. Excel, word, pdf, you can fill your own file name system start exporting and then ask you file name and location. At least that is benefit coming back to us, while struggling with the report creations read post from alex chow. Images with transparent background will not show correctly when opened in pdf. With respect continue reading workaround to report. Microsoft report viewer 2010 is required for save as excel or save as pdf. How to save commonly used filters in dynamics nav archerpoint. Microsoft dynamics nav 20 setup installs microsoft sql server report.

Before nav 20 so lets try this with a standard report report 206 sales invoice with nav 20. Saveasexcel not supported in business central cloud saas version. By default, when a report uses an rdlc report layout at runtime, fonts are embedded in the generated pdf. Apr 23, 20 working with images in rdlc reports and visual studio 2010 in nav 20 are unfortunately not done without doing some workarounds. You can save rdlc reports as pdf documents in dynamics nav 2009 r2 to be fair, you could do this for years now starting with dynamics nav 2009. However, you cannot run or design a report that has a classic report layout. Runrequestpage this function lets you run a request page for a report, without actually running the report. Nav 20 r2 pdf report issue developers forum dynamics. I have seen couple of times the requirement where we need to print a document from nav which is not a report, it could be a marketing campai.

Using dynamics nav web services to send a pdf to a web service, in this case for a web portal. A saving to pdf window shows the status of the process. Setdata is broken in nav 20 with report viewer 2010. The reason is that temporary server file as not allowed to be saved for some security reasons. Saveaspdf command creating dynamically the file name. Print send to excel do not export all columns few weeks ago, i ran into a strange issue and in this blog i will. You experience slow performance when you save a report to pdf in the web client. When using the reports fornav designer, you can save as custom layout with any microsoft dynamics nav license. Apr 24, 2014 in other words, how to create a conditional page break in a microsoft dynamics nav 20 rtc report. This controls things like output path, watermarks, and all the other settings. Microsoft dynamics nav 20 warehouse and inventory management supply chain management module duration. The report to pdf conversion its working fine but as u suggest in that when the report is run it should print and make pdf of that. Create a new text field in user setup table and add same to form say path to save report.

An email must be sent to customer when a sales invoice is posted in which sales invoice is attached. Rdlc export directly to excel or pdf from codebehind aug 25, 2011 05. Microsoft dynamics nav client 20, 20 r2, 2015, 2016, 2017, 2018 or business central. I also wrote about a workaround to something related to this, you can find the post here. When i was running nav 2009 i used pdfcreator, biopdf or bullzippdf printers to create a pdf copy of a report. System requirements for microsoft dynamics nav 2017 erpxperts. System requirements for microsoft dynamics nav 20 r2 contents system requirements for microsoft dynamics nav 20 r2 3 system requirements for the microsoft dynamics nav windows client 3. You know you can save report as pdf on the rtc client, but not on the. System requirements for microsoft dynamics nav 20 r2 3. Email documents as pdf using streams marcellus blog. This report is already grouped by salesperson, but now we will add the option to add a page break by salesperson new page per salesperson. When you upgrade a report, the classic report layout and the request form are deleted. The code i use to render a single report as a pdf is. Jun 19, 2018 email documents as pdf using streams i started collecting some code pieces that i find myself using often on github.

Singleinstance codeunits were introduced years ago. Depending on dataitems in report you may have to use custlocal or custbill variable as last parameter. How to run a report, save it as pdf and send to email recipient as a job queue entry that will run every day verified create a function in the report which will assign the value for the parameters and call this function before calling saveaspdf. Update rollup 2 for microsoft dynamics nav 20 r2 build.